In 1961, the FCC awards license to Norfolk and Hampton School system to operate WHRO-TV, Channel 15, as Virginia's first noncommercial, educational television station. In 1963, WHRO-TV moves into studio-office facility on Hampton Boulevard in Norfolk. In 1966, utilization of instruction programs on WHRO-TV is expanded to cities of Newport News, Portsmouth, Chesapeake, Virginia Beach, Suffolk and Nansemond, wplyrhe.simongosselin.fr York and Isle of Wight Counties. In 1968, participating school qnge.scuolasancasciano.it divisions formally incorporate to own and govern the station as the Hampton Roads Educational Television Associations (HRETA), Inc., a private nonprofit educational corporation. In 1975, the Virginia Cultural Foundation formally transfers the license of WTGM-FM (89.5 FM) to HRETA to stabilize and preserve public radio in Hampton Roads. In 1976, HRETA expands and revises its charter as the Hampton Roads Educational Telecommunications Association, Inc. Participation on the Board of Directors and community advisory bodies of the station is expanded and broadened. In 1978, call letters of WTGM are changed to WHRO-FM to present a more unified public broadcasting service in Hampton Roads. In 1983, the sale of WGH-FM, the commercial fine arts radio station in Newport News, prompts expansion of classical music and fine arts programming on WHRO-FM with opportunities for increased listenership and community support. Exploration of activation of a second FM station is launched. In 1984, WHRO conducts a feasibility study on developing a second FM public radio station. In 1985, an FCC "freeze" on noncommercial FM applications postpones indefinitely the approval of WHRO's plan to activate a second FM public station. But in 1988, a construction permit to activate a second FM public radio station is issued by the FCC. In 1991, WHRO activates a second non-commercial FM radio station. Public radio programming services are separated -- news and information, jazz-folk-alternative music on 89.5 FM (WHRV-FM) and classical and fine arts programming on 90.3 FM (WHRO-FM). Moved to 102.5 from 100.9 on 2/27/2009 at 7:15 a.m. On 10/14/2008, the FCC grantes the move from 100.9 to 102.5. In September 2008, The Popular Assembly Of New Horizons 3000 And His Successors' Adult Album Alternative/Public Radio "Revolutionary Radio Williamsburg" WRRW-LP/100.9 Williamsburg wanted to move to an abandoned LPFM frequency granted to the city. New Horizons 3000 requested to move from 100.9 to 102.5 FM, previously licensed to Christian Life Center of Williamsburg as WJRX-LP. CFC ran the station with a Christian Variety format known as "The Rain" but eventually they took the station dark and surrendered their license in April 2008. With Cox Radio moving its Alternative "Y101" WDYL/101.1 Chester to 100.9/Lakeside, the WRRW signal also on 100.9, would be greatly compromised.
